    Microneedling, a popular skin rejuvenation treatment, involves using tiny needles to create micro-injuries in the skin, which stimulates collagen production and promotes healing. In Westmount, the healing process after microneedling typically follows a predictable timeline.

    Immediately post-treatment, the skin may appear red and feel sensitive, similar to a mild sunburn. This initial redness usually lasts between 24 to 48 hours. During this period, it's crucial to keep the skin clean and moisturized to aid in the healing process.

    By the third day, the redness should start to subside, and the skin may begin to flake or peel lightly. This is a normal part of the healing process as the skin regenerates. By the end of the first week, most patients notice a significant improvement in skin texture and tone.

    However, full healing can take up to two weeks, depending on the individual's skin type and the extent of the treatment. During this period, it's essential to avoid direct sun exposure and use sunscreen to protect the newly formed skin cells.

    In summary, while the initial redness and sensitivity from microneedling in Westmount may last a couple of days, the complete healing process can take up to two weeks. Following post-treatment care instructions diligently can help ensure optimal results and a quicker recovery.

    Understanding the Healing Process After Microneedling in Westmount

    Microneedling, a popular cosmetic procedure, involves using tiny needles to create micro-injuries in the skin. These injuries stimulate the body's natural healing process, promoting collagen and elastin production, which can improve skin texture and reduce signs of aging. However, many patients wonder about the healing timeline post-procedure. Here’s a detailed look at what to expect.

    Initial Reaction and Recovery

    Immediately after microneedling, your skin may appear red and flushed, similar to a mild sunburn. This reaction is normal and is a sign that the treatment is working. Over the next 24 to 48 hours, this redness will gradually subside. It's crucial to keep the skin clean and moisturized during this period to prevent any infection and to aid in the healing process.

    Peeling and Flaking

    By the third day post-treatment, you might notice some mild peeling or flaking of the skin. This is a natural part of the healing process as the skin regenerates. Avoid picking at the skin to prevent scarring. Instead, use a gentle, non-comedogenic moisturizer to keep the skin hydrated and comfortable.

    Continued Improvement

    By the end of the first week, most of the redness and flaking should have resolved. Your skin may still feel slightly sensitive, but overall, you should start to see an improvement in texture and a reduction in fine lines and pores. The full benefits of microneedling often take several weeks to become fully apparent as collagen production continues.

    Long-Term Results

    In the weeks following the procedure, your skin will continue to heal and improve. Many patients notice a significant enhancement in skin tone and texture by the fourth week. For optimal results, it's often recommended to undergo a series of microneedling treatments spaced several weeks apart.

    Post-Treatment Care

    To ensure the best possible outcome, follow your dermatologist's post-treatment care instructions carefully. This typically includes avoiding direct sun exposure, using sunscreen, and refraining from using harsh skincare products. Proper care will not only speed up the healing process but also enhance the long-term benefits of microneedling.

    In conclusion, the healing process after microneedling in Westmount typically spans about a week, with noticeable improvements continuing over the following weeks. By adhering to proper post-treatment care, you can maximize the benefits of this effective skin rejuvenation treatment.
